Department of Defense Reports Travelan Protects Against Shigella in Primates
Australia, September 05, 2018: Immuron Limited (ASX: IMC; NASDQ: IMRN), an Australian microbiome biopharmaceutical company focused
on developing and commercializing oral immunotherapeutics for the prevention and treatment of many gut mediated pathogens, today
is pleased to provide shareholders with an update on the company's cooperative research and development agreements with
the US Department of Defense (US DoD).
US DoD commissioned several studies to characterise the antibodies within Travelan , the company's
commercially available flagship over-the-counter gastrointestinal
and digestive health supplement. The aim was to conduct trials to determine the product's effectiveness
in neutralising pathogenic gastrointestinal bacterial infections as a preventative treatment for US military personnel and civilians
stationed or traveling in locations where such infections may be debilitating.
US Armed Forces Research Institute of Medical Sciences (AFRIMS), an overseas laboratory of the Walter Reed Army Institute of
Research (WRAIR), located in Bangkok, Thailand, conducted the study that evaluated the therapeutic potential of Travelan in
a non-human primate (NHP) preclinical challenge model that closely mimics the disease seen in humans. The study was performed
in collaboration with the Department of Enteric Diseases and the Department of Veterinary Medicine, AFRIMS, and
the Department of Enteric Infections, Bacterial Diseases Branch, WRAIR.
placebo-controlled study was carried out in 12 NHPs segregated into 2 groups: a Travelan treatment cohort
of 8 and a placebo cohort of 4, which were treated with either Travelan or placebo respectively twice daily
for a total of 12 doses over a 6-day period. The animals received treatment for 3-days prior to oral challenge with ~3 x 109
viable Shigella flexneri strain 2a organisms. All (4 of 4 - 100%) placebo-treated animals displayed acute dysentery
symptoms within 24 - 36 hours of Shigella flexneri 2a challenge. A single (1 of 8 - 12.5%) of the Travelan -treated
cohort displayed dysentery symptoms at this time point. The remaining individuals (7 of 8 - 87.5%) in the Travelan
treatment cohort remained symptom-free to 4-days post Shigella flexneri 2a challenge. Once the treatment period
was concluded a second individual in the Travelan treatment group developed symptoms (2 of 8 - 25%).
remainder (6 of 8 - 75%) of the Travelan treated cohort remained symptom-free to the conclusion
of the study 11-days post Shigella flexneri 2a challenge.

The global burden of diarrhoeal
diseases outweighs any of the more complex diseases seen in gastroenterology clinics. Every year, there are an estimated 1.5 billion
episodes of diarrhea worldwide. These episodes result in the deaths of approximately
2.2 million people, mostly children in developing countries (https://www.ncbi.nlm.nih.gov/pmc/articles/PMC2699001/). A
preventative treatment that protects against enteric diseases, specifically Shigella, is a high priority objective for the US
Army. Shigella is estimated to cause 80 -165 million cases of disease worldwide, resulting in 600,000 deaths annually
and is particularly prevalent in both sub-Saharan Africa and South Asia.

Travellers' diarrhea
diarrhoea is a gastro-intestinal infection with symptoms that include loose, watery (and occasionally bloody) stools, abdominal
cramping, bloating, and fever, Entropathogenic bacteria are responsible for most cases, with enterotoxigenic Escherichia coli
(ETEC) playing a dominant causative role. Campylobacter spp. are also responsible for a significant proportion of cases. The more
serious infections with Salmonella spp. the bacillary dysentery organisms belonging to Shigella spp. and Vibrio spp. (the causative
agent of cholera) are often confused with travellers' diarrhoea as they may be contracted while travelling and initial symptoms
are often indistinguishable.
